Description
The Gravity: Digital Push Button (Blue) is an easy-to-use digital input module designed for interactive microcontroller projects. Featuring an onboard status LED and a durable coloured cap, it is ideal for students, educators, and makers adding physical switching to their builds.
Durable keypad with colourful cap
The module features a large push button topped with a vibrant blue cap and built on an immersion gold surface finish. Designed for extended press life, it provides reliable tactile input for various interactive creations.

Wide operating voltage range
Operating across a 3.3V to 5V supply voltage, the push button integrates directly with standard 3.3V and 5V development boards. The digital interface provides simple plug-and-play connectivity.
Clear labelling and onboard LED
An onboard indicator LED illuminates during operation for immediate visual feedback. The board also features clear D labelling and descriptive rear iconography to simplify sensor identification.
Standard mounting and compact size
Measuring 22 mm by 30 mm, the board incorporates dual 3 mm mounting holes positioned at standard 5 mm grid intervals for straightforward physical assembly into robotics chassis and enclosures.
Included package contents
The package includes one Gravity blue digital push button board alongside one compatible digital sensor connection cable.
